I'm guessing southbend, but does anyone think there is a better clutch for a 2007 dodge with a chipped 6.7?

I replaced the stock clutch at about 90k a year and a half ago because of a un preventable situation that was knowones or the trucks fault, I put a Valeo in it and at the time it was stock, a while back I finally got tired of issues with the exhaust filters so we removed them and put a chip in it. The clutch is starting to slip with a load on so I'm guessing that clutch just won't hold the extra power, it's just got 50k on it so I can't think it would be anything other than that.

Show me the link you found. I suppose these pieces are so much $ because the kit includes a dual mass flywheel? We use to send our disc/pressure plate to Centerforce and they would feline disc and do their magic to the PP.
 
I would look at southbend or valair, both are pretty well regarded by the guys putting down power. If you can get a southbend installed for $1400, I would jump on it. I just had a sachs clutch installed installed on my 07 6.7 for $1100 a few weeks ago, but that included a single mass flywheel conversion and was a stock power level replacement as I don't intend to mod my truck.

Centerforce makes a good clutch, but I don't know much about them when it comes to diesels. My buddies used to run them on race cars when I was younger.
